.section1{width:100%;height:auto;background: url("../img/sybg1.jpg") no-repeat center top;padding:150px 0;overflow: hidden;}
.syspL{width: 525px;
    padding-left: 20px;}
.syspR{    margin-top: 40px;
    background: url(../img/syvideobtn.png) no-repeat;
    width: 77px;
    height: 78px;
    display: block;
    margin-right: 90px;}
.syspR:hover{background: url("../img/videobtniconcur.png") no-repeat;}
.syspL h2{    font-size: 30px;
    margin-left: 45px;
    color: #fff;
    font-weight: normal;
    padding: 5px 30px;
    margin-bottom: 35px;
    background: url(../img/icons/line33.png) no-repeat left center;}
.syspL p{font-size: 22px;
    color: #CCCCCC;
    line-height: 30px;
    text-align: center;}
.yxhzPicList li p.syjx{background: #fff;color:#666666;font-size: 18px;font-family: princeton_monticello,Georgia,sans-serif;}
.yxhzPicList li p.syjx a{color:#333333}
.yxhzPicList li p.syjx a:hover{color:#9A0000}
.syTit{margin-bottom: 40px;overflow: hidden;position: relative;width:100%;}
.syTit p a{position: absolute; right: 0;bottom: 0;}
.educationNav li.active span{
    color: #990000;
}
.educationNav li {
    float: left;

    cursor: pointer;
}
.syTit span{padding-right: 20px;font-size: 26px;color: #990000;}
.educationNav li.active a.more {
    display: block;
}
.educationNav li a.more {
    position: absolute;
    right: 0;
    display: none;
    bottom: 0;
}
.educationNav li.active  a.xwlink{color: #990000;}
.educationNav li a.xwlink{position: relative;display: inline;color: #9A9A9A;}

.section2{padding-top: 40px;}
.section3{background: #F1F1F1;padding: 40px 0;overflow: hidden}
.section3L{width:894px;float: left;}
.section3R{width:264px;float: right;}
.notice1{overflow: hidden;margin-left: -3%;}
.notice1 li{float: left;width:30%;margin-left: 3%}

.notice1 li img{width: 100%;height: 180px;}
.innovateTxt{background: #fff;padding: 20px;}
.innovateTxt a{font-size: 16px;color: #333333;line-height: 26px;height: 57px;display: block;overflow:hidden; 

text-overflow:ellipsis;

display:-webkit-box; 

-webkit-box-orient:vertical;

-webkit-line-clamp:2;font-family: princeton_monticello,Georgia,sans-serif; }
.innovateTxt a:hover{color:#9A0000}
.innovateTxt p{color:#999999;font-size: 15px;margin-top: 10px;}
.view li{margin-top: 40px;}
.viewTime{padding:5px 10px;background: #9A0000;}
.viewTime span{font-size: 30px;color:#fff;text-align: center;display: block;}
.viewTime b{display: block;text-align: center;color:#CCCCCC;font-size: 12px;font-weight: normal;}
.viewTxt{width:180px;margin-left: 15px;}
.viewTxt a{font-size: 16px;color:#333333;display: block;display: -webkit-box;  -webkit-box-orient: vertical;  -webkit-line-clamp: 2;  overflow: hidden;height:48px;line-height: 24px;font-family: princeton_monticello,Georgia,sans-serif;}
.viewTxt a:hover{color:#9A0000}
.viewTxt p{font-size: 14px;color:#666666;margin-top: 20px;display: -webkit-box;  -webkit-box-orient: vertical;  -webkit-line-clamp: 3;  overflow: hidden;height:66px;line-height: 22px;}
#syslick{margin-bottom: 0;}
.banner:hover #syslick .slick-prev,.banner:hover #syslick .slick-next{visibility: visible;}
#syslick .slick-prev{background: url("../img/bannerleft.png") no-repeat;width:61px;height:92px;left:10%;visibility: hidden}
#syslick .slick-next{background: url("../img/bannerright.png") no-repeat;width:61px;height:92px;right:10%;visibility: hidden}
#syslick .slick-prev:before,#syslick .slick-next:before{content: ""}
#syslick .slick-prev:hover{background: url("../img/bannerleft2.png") no-repeat;}
#syslick .slick-next:hover{background: url("../img/bannerright2.png") no-repeat;}
.banner{position: relative}
.top{position: absolute;  top: 0;  left: 0;  z-index: 100;right: 0;}
.top .head{height:auto;padding:0;}
.top .toolBox2{padding: 16px 0;}
.nav2{width:100%;height:70px;background: url("../img/navbg.png") no-repeat center top;}
.menu li{float: left;margin-left: 10px;line-height: 70px;position: relative}
.menu li a{font-size: 16px;color:#FFFFFF;}
.syej{position: absolute;top:70px;left:-20px;background: url(../img/ejbg.png) repeat;border-top: 2px solid #C02727;width:174px;padding: 10px;display: none}
.syej dd{text-align: center;line-height: 20px;padding:10px 0px;}
.syej dd:hover a{color:#990000;}
.notice1{overflow: hidden;margin-left: -3%;}
.notice1 li{float: left;width:30%;margin-left: 3%;overflow: hidden}
.notice1 li .npic{width:100%;overflow: hidden;height:200px;
    transition: all 0.6s;
}
.notice1 li .npic a.innovatePic{display: block;width:100%;height:100%;overflow: hidden;transition: all 0.6s;}
.notice1 li:hover .npic a.innovatePic{transform: scale(1.2);}


.yxhzPicList{overflow: hidden;margin-left: -3%;}
.yxhzPicList li{width: 22%;
    margin-left: 3%;
    float: left;overflow: hidden}
.yxhzPicList li .npic{width:100%;overflow: hidden;height:auto;
    transition: all 0.6s;
}
.yxhzPicList li .npic a.innovatePic{display: block;width:100%;height:100%;overflow: hidden;transition: all 0.6s;}
.yxhzPicList li:hover .npic a.innovatePic{transform: scale(1.2);}
@media screen and (max-width: 1217px){
    .section1{background-size:cover;padding:20px 0;}
    .section3L{width:700px;}
    .menu li{margin-left: 30px;}
}
@media screen and (max-width: 1020px){
    .section1{background-size:cover;}
    .section3L{width:auto;float: none;margin-bottom: 40px;}
    .section3R{width:auto;float: none;}
    .view{overflow: hidden;margin-left: -40px;}
    .view li{float: left;margin-left: 40px;}
    .top{display: none}
}
@media screen and (max-width: 770px){
    .yxhzPicList li{width:47%}
    .yxhzPicList li p.syjx{font-size: 12px;}
    .syspL{width:auto;float: none}
    .syspR{float: none;display: block;text-align: right;width:40px;height:40px;background:100%;margin:20px auto 0px!important}
    .syspR:hover{background:100%}
    .syspL h2{font-size: 18px;margin-left:0;margin-bottom:15px;}
    .notice1 li {
        float: left;
        width: 47%;
        margin-left: 3%;
        margin-bottom: 20px;
    }
    .fd-con .ll-con p{font-size: 12px !important; line-height: 26px !important;}
    .fd-copy{  padding-top: 15px; padding-bottom: 15px;  font-size: 12px;}
    .syspL p{text-align:left;font-size: 16px; line-height: 22px;}
    .yxhzPicList{margin-bottom:0;}
    .section2,.section3,.section1{padding:20px 0;}
    .syTit{margin-bottom:20px;}
    .section3L{margin-bottom:0;}
    .view li{margin-left:0;width:100%;margin-top:0;margin-bottom:20px;}
    .view{margin-left:0;}
    .viewTxt{width: calc(100% - 85px);}
    .footlogo img{width:80px;}
    .fd-top {
        padding: 10px 0 20px;
    }
    .footlogo {
       top: -60px;
        right: 0;
       margin: auto;
       width: auto; 
     }
}
@media screen and (max-width: 400px){
    .notice1{margin-left: 0;}
    .notice1 li {
        float: left;
        width: 100%;
        margin-left: 0;
        margin-bottom: 20px;
    }
}



.fd-con .ll-con{float: left;    width: 450px;    margin: 0 50px 0 0;}
.fd-con .ll-con h3{color:#b9b9b9; font-size:16px;margin: 0 0 15px 0;}
.fd-con .ll-con p{color:#818181;font-size:14px;line-height:34px;}
.fd-con .end_logo{width: 330px;    float: left;    height: auto;    overflow: hidden;margin: 0 50px 0 0;}
.fd-con .end_logo li{margin: 0 0 34px 0;}
.fd-con .end_gzjh{width: 260px;    float: left;}
.fd-con .end_gzjh h3{color:#b9b9b9; font-size:16px;margin: 0 0 15px 0;}
.fd-con .end_gzjh a{color:#818181; font-size:14px;line-height:30px;}
.fd-con .end_gzjh a:hover{color:#c0c0c0; }
.fd-con .r-con{float: right;
    width: 106px;
    position: relative;
    z-index: 999;
    line-height: 30px;
    text-align: center;}
.fd-con .r-con span{display: block;    width: 100%;color:#818181;    text-align: center;    font-size: 13px;    padding: 10px 0 0 0;line-height: 20px;}
.end_gzjh_more{text-align: right;    padding: 0 55px 0;}


@media screen and (max-width: 1217px)
list.css:817
.fd-con .ll-con {
    float: left;
    width: 83%;
    display: block;
}
@media screen and (max-width: 1217px){

   .footlogo img{width:60px;}
    .fd-top {
        padding: 10px 0 20px;
    }
    .footlogo {
       top: -60px;
        right: 0;
       margin: auto;
       width: auto; 
     }
.fd-con .r-con p{margin-bottom: 15px;}
    .fd-top .share{text-align:center;border-top: 1px solid #292929;padding-top: 20px;}
    .fd-con .r-con {
        float: none;
        width: auto;
        color: rgba(255,255,255,.25);
        text-align: center;
        padding: 20px;
        border-left: 0;
    }
    .fd-con .end_logo{display: none;}
 .fd-con .end_gzjh{display: none;}
 .fd-con .r-con{display: none;}


    .fd-con .ll-con {
float: left;
    width: 100% !important;
    margin: 0 0 0 0 !important;
    text-align: center;
    }

.fd-con .ll-con h3{display: block;}

.fd-top {
    padding: 10px 0 20px !important;
}

    .globalTxt h1{font-size: 20px;}
    .globalTxt {
        width: 42%;
        padding-right: 5%;
        display: table;
        height: 232px;
    }
}
}
@media screen and (max-width: 1217px)
list.css:826
.fd-con .end_logo {
    display: none;
}
	

@media screen and (max-width: 1217px)
list.css:831
.fd-con .ll-con {
    float: left;
    width: 100% !important;
    margin: 0 0 0 0 !important;
    text-align: center;
}
@media screen and (max-width: 1217px)
list.css:828
.fd-con .r-con {
    display: none;
}

@media screen and (max-width: 1217px)
list.css:831
.fd-con .ll-con {
    float: left;
    width: 100% !important;
    margin: 0 0 0 0 !important;
    text-align: center;
}

@media screen and (max-width: 1217px)
list.css:818
.fd-con .r-con {
    float: none;
    width: auto;
    color: rgba(255,255,255,.25);
    text-align: center;
    padding: 20px;
    border-left: 0;
}